Andy Cooperman

(American, born 1958)

Andy Cooperman is a jeweler and metalsmith who makes all sorts of things from all sorts of things and for all sorts of reasons. He is known for applying the craft, traditions, and discipline of metalsmithing to materials ranging from ping-pong balls to porcupine quills, and sterling silver to stainless steel. Cooperman has been a working artist for over forty years, as well as writing and teaching. He lives and works in Seattle, Western Washington.
